一种金属制品磷化处理液
技术领域
本发明涉及一种金属制品磷化处理液。
背景技术
磷化是常用的前处理技术,原理上应属于化学转换膜处理,主要应用于钢铁表面磷化,有色金属(如铝、锌)件也可应用磷化。磷化是一种化学与电化学反应形成磷酸盐化学转化膜的过程,所形成的磷酸盐转化膜称之为磷化膜。磷化的目的主要是:给基体金属提供保护,在一定程度上防止金属被腐蚀;用于涂漆前打底,提高漆膜层的附着力与防腐蚀能力;在金属冷加工工艺中起减摩润滑作用。
发明内容
针对现有技术的不足,本发明要解决的技术问题是,提供一种金属制品磷化处理液,能够对金属进行有效的保护,同时具有很好的化学稳定性,使用方便。
为解决现有技术的不足,本发明采取的技术方案是:一种金属制品磷化处理液,由以下重量份数的原料制成:脂肪醇聚氧乙烯醚6-14份,十二醇硫酸酯钠6-8份,聚偏磷酸钠6-9份,十二烷基硫酸钠3-8份,氟化铵2-6份,乙基三乙氧基硅烷2-7份,四甲基溴化铵4-9份,γ-(甲基丙烯酰氧)丙基三甲氧基硅烷5-7份,磷酸8-14份,碳酸钾2-6份,双氧水1-5份。
本发明优化的技术方案是,一种金属制品磷化处理液,由以下重量份数的原料制成:脂肪醇聚氧乙烯醚10份,十二醇硫酸酯钠7份,聚偏磷酸钠8份,十二烷基硫酸钠6份,氟化铵4份,乙基三乙氧基硅烷5份,四甲基溴化铵7份,γ-(甲基丙烯酰氧)丙基三甲氧基硅烷6份,磷酸11份,碳酸钾4份,双氧水3份。
本发明的有益效果是,本发明的金属制品磷化处理液,能够对金属进行有效的保护,同时具有很好的化学稳定性,使用方便。
具体实施方式
实施例1
一种金属制品磷化处理液,由以下重量份数的原料制成:脂肪醇聚氧乙烯醚6份,十二醇硫酸酯钠6份,聚偏磷酸钠6份,十二烷基硫酸钠3份,氟化铵2份,乙基三乙氧基硅烷2份,四甲基溴化铵4份,γ-(甲基丙烯酰氧)丙基三甲氧基硅烷5份,磷酸8份,碳酸钾2份,双氧水1份。
实施例2
一种金属制品磷化处理液,由以下重量份数的原料制成:脂肪醇聚氧乙烯醚14份,十二醇硫酸酯钠8份,聚偏磷酸钠9份,十二烷基硫酸钠8份,氟化铵6份,乙基三乙氧基硅烷7份,四甲基溴化铵9份,γ-(甲基丙烯酰氧)丙基三甲氧基硅烷7份,磷酸14份,碳酸钾6份,双氧水5份。
实施例3
一种金属制品磷化处理液,由以下重量份数的原料制成:脂肪醇聚氧乙烯醚10份,十二醇硫酸酯钠7份,聚偏磷酸钠8份,十二烷基硫酸钠6份,氟化铵4份,乙基三乙氧基硅烷5份,四甲基溴化铵7份,γ-(甲基丙烯酰氧)丙基三甲氧基硅烷6份,磷酸11份,碳酸钾4份,双氧水3份。
